Summary:
This paper describes the development of a ΔP system for measuring and controlling the mass of liquid hydrogen in a tank to an accuracy of better than 1%. Included are descriptions of the components, an error analysis, and test data. To illustrate the sensitivity and accuracy of the mass measuring system, a description of its use in measuring the weight of air in the empty tank is given. The paper also includes a discussion of the applicability of this system to various industrial measuring, metering, and control problems
